■12. Connecting a sensorless servo (FREQROL-E700EX series)
Make the communication settings of the sensorless servo (FREQROL-E700EX series).
Be sure to perform the inverter reset after updating each parameter.
(1) Communication port and corresponding parameters
GOT connection destination
PU connector
FR-E7TR
(RS-485 terminal block)
(2) Communication settings of sensorless servo
Set the following parameters using the PU (operation panel or parameter unit).
Do not change these parameters, even though they can be monitored from the GOT. If they are changed,
communication with the GOT is disabled.
